WebAug 21, 2024 · A breast lump is a swelling, outgrowth, or protrusion in the breast. Both women and men have breast tissue. This normal tissue may respond to changes in hormone levels, leading to breast lumps. Lumps in the breast may come and go depending on hormone levels. Anemia + anxiety could cover all of your symptoms ... msu spanish coursesWebJan 3, 2024 · Here’s how the symptoms of fibrocystic breast changes and breast cancer compare. 1. Fibrocystic breast changes: Cause lumps that may be painful. Are most common at ages 30—50. Can cause lumps that change throughout the menstrual cycle, becoming worse just before your period.
